How to download latest version of itunes on an OS X Mac?

I have an OS X Macbook Pro. When I updated my phone and plugged it into the computer it said that it couldn't interact with the phone until itunes was updated to 11 or something like that. When I tried downloading that update it requires my computer have the 10.6.8 update, which I can't get because that requires a 10.6 Snow update. All I want to do is change the songs on my iphone

Unfortunately, you don't really have much of a choice then. Your only option would be to actually upgrade to a newer version of OS X.

You will need to purchase Snow Leopard. Or check your specs and see if you can go directly to Mavericks, which is OS 10.9 and is free to download.

To be sure your iTunes is as up to date as possible, click the Apple logo in the top menu bar, and choose "Software Update". You can never use the latest iTunes with OS 10.5.8.

If you want the "latest" iTunes, buy a newer computer. Old Macs can't use the latest iTunes, latest OS version. To use the latest iTunes, you need Mid 2007 or newer MacBook Pro.
